在将RestConfigurationRule从serenity 1.5.11迁移到2.6.0时,需要注意以下几个步骤:
- 确认版本兼容性:首先,确保serenity 2.6.0与你的项目的其他依赖项兼容。查阅serenity的官方文档或发布说明,了解新版本的变化和要求。
- 更新依赖项:在你的项目的构建文件(如pom.xml或build.gradle)中,将serenity的版本更新为2.6.0。同时,确保其他相关依赖项也更新到与新版本兼容的版本。
- 迁移RestConfigurationRule:在serenity 2.6.0中,RestConfigurationRule已经发生了一些变化。根据新版本的文档,了解新的配置规则和用法。
- 更新测试代码:根据新的RestConfigurationRule的用法,更新你的测试代码。可能需要修改一些配置参数或方法调用,以适应新版本的规则。
- 运行和测试:完成代码更新后,运行你的测试套件,确保所有测试用例都能够通过。如果有失败的测试用例,检查错误日志和报告,修复可能的问题。
总结起来,将RestConfigurationRule从serenity 1.5.11迁移到2.6.0的关键步骤包括确认版本兼容性、更新依赖项、迁移配置规则、更新测试代码和运行测试。在迁移过程中,可以参考serenity的官方文档和示例代码,以便更好地理解和应用新版本的规则。